Edit Chart Properties
The chart property editor lets you define all the chart’s properties, split into six tabs.
Chart tab
Chart Type: When you select a chart type, a sample is displayed in chart plot area. Types include: Ver-
tical Bar, Vertical Line, Pie, X/Y Trend, and Time Trend. (No trend samples are displayed.)
NOTE: The Pie Chart is a special case. See “Defining a Pie Chart” on page 4-86

Method Name What it does
Disable Disables the control; it cannot be used
Enable Enables the control so it can be used
Hide Makes the control invisible
Reset Resets chart to zero (XY Trend only)
Run Forces the chart to update
Show Makes the control visible
Event Name When it happens
Chart Data
Change
When any chart data value changes
